

June Borges, 97, died late on the evening of September 17th after enjoying a full day of visits from family and friends and sharing of love and prayers. June was born in Paia on July 21st, 1928. She attended Paia School and graduated from Maui High in 1946. Growing up, June and her family were faithful parishioners of Holy Rosary Church. She is the second child of Alfred Pico Sr. and Fannie Souza Pico. She is preceded in death by parents, older sister Adeline and younger brother Alfred Jr. June is also preceded in death by her husband of 51 years, Deacon Joseph Borges and her son, Thomas Jon Borges. She is survived by her sister, Anita Boteilho and her 3 remaining children, Marianne Okamura, Anita Carrington, and Joseph Borges Jr.
After high school, June worked at Kress Store on main street in Wailuku until she married in 1952 and moved to South Bend Indiana with Joe as he finished his degree at Notre Dame University. They returned to Hawaii in 1959 and lived on Oahu until 1972 when they moved back to Maui. Since then, she been a parishioner at St. Anthony Church where her funeral service will be held on October 11th. Viewing begins at 8:30am and Holy Mass will be celebrated at 11:00am. Burial will be held on Monday, October 13, 2025 at 2pm at Maui Memorial Park in Wailuku. A special Mahalo to Islands Hospice for their tender care.
